Joe Venuti is a weather producer and fill-in meteorologist for WCVB-TV Channel 5. He joined the station in 2006 after serving as the weekend/fill-in meteorologist at WLVI-TV, Boston for the previous five years.

Venuti launched his broadcast career as an intern in the Channel 5 weather office, working with the legendary Bob Copeland. Before returning to WCVB, he went on to do meteorological research for the US Air Force, MIT, and worked on-air at WPSX-TV, Pennsylvania. Venuti was the morning and noon meteorologist at WGME-TV, Portland, Maine prior to joining WLVI.

A frequent guest speaker in local schools on weather and science related topics, Venuti is a graduate of the University of Massachusetts at Lowell. He earned his Masters of Science in Meteorology at Penn State. In 1997, Venuti was awarded the American Meteorological Society Seal of Approval in recognition of his professionalism in weather forecasting and reporting.

The Massachusetts native was born in Revere and grew up in Reading. He is married and has two sons.
